خلاصه مقاله:
This Study examined the use of lexical cohesion in English political news articles published in local and international English newspapers. To this end, a corpus of ۴۰.۰۰۰ words (۲۰.۰۰۰ in each corpus) were randomly collected from political news articles published online in the editorial section of international English newspapers (e.g. the Washington Post, the New York Times) and local English newspapers (e.g. Iran front Page, Tehran Times) from January to December, and were analyzed based on Tanskanen’s (۲۰۰۶) classification of lexical cohesion as reiteration and collocation. The findings showed that international English newspaper used statistically more substitution, equivalence, contrast, activity related, and elaborative collocations than local English newspapers. On the other hand, local English newspapers used significantly more simple repetition, complex repetition, generalization specification, co-specification, and order set collocation when writing political news article. Additionally, there was a significant difference between the two groups in subset of reiteration and collocation.
